Latest Patents

William H. Byler holds a patent for a process titled "Sequential residue hydrodesulfurization and thermal cracking operations." This process involves passing a first stream of residual oil and hydrogen downwardly through a zone containing hydrodesulfurization catalyst under specific conditions until the catalyst is deactivated. Following this, a second stream of residual oil and hydrogen is passed upwardly through the deactivated catalyst under thermal cracking conditions, which includes temperatures exceeding those used in hydrodesulfurization. This innovative approach aims to improve the overall efficiency of oil processing.
